Q: Is 8,389,122 a Prime Number?
A: No, 8,389,122 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 8389122 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 7 14 21 42 199,741 399,482 599,223 1,198,446 1,398,187 2,796,374 4,194,561 and 8,389,122, with no remainder.
Since 8,389,122 cannot be divided by just 1 and 8,389,122, it is not a prime number.
